Huge Turnout at Denver Tax Day Tea Party

Posted on April 15, 2009 at 3:00pm 3 Comments

I just got back from the Tax Day Tea Party in Denver, where a diverse crowd of about 5,000 people gathered to hear patriotic music and pro-liberty speakers. It was an amazing crowd, making the west side of the State Capitol reverberate with different chants, such as: "No, You Can't" / "Let Freedom Ring" / "Don't Tread on Me" / and "Where is Ritter?" (in reference to our pro-tax Democrat governor). All in all a good family event with lots of energy, enthusiasm, applause, signs waving, horns… Continue
